The novel is about a young couple, saeed and nadia, who live in an unnamed city undergoing civil war and finally have to flee, using a system of magical doors, which lead to different locations around the globe. Mohsin hamid was born in pakistan, but he spent much of his childhood in palo alto, california while his father pursued a phd at stanford university.
